My car is a red 1992 Mustang GT. It has 110,000 miles on it. The first 100,000 were put on the car by a now 60 year old woman that absolutely adored the car. It has never been smoked in. The body and paint is entirely original and the red paint is very red. Barely faded anywhere on the car. The only body part that is not original is the Cervini's fiberglass ram air hood. The grey/black two-toned leather interior is broken in looking but is rip/tear/hole free. The car runs great and pulls hard. Car has power windows, power driver seat, and cruise control. Modifications
---------
Stock 302
Stock Heads and Cam
GT40 Upper/Lower Intake
76mm Ford Racing Mass Air Sensor
30 lb Injectors
70mm BBK Throttle Body
New 195 degree thermostat
New Aluminum Radiator w/ hoses
Cervini's Ram Air Hood w/ box
K&N Air Filter
Ford Racing Dyno Tuned SS Shorty Headers
Ford Racing Dyno Tuned O/R H Pipe
3.5" Magna Flow SS Tips (Not turn downs, very slight angle)
8.8 Rearend wit 3.73's
Hurst short throw shift kit w/ T handle hurst shifter
Weld Draglites
15x4 - 155/50/15 BFGs
15x8 - 295/50/15 Mickey Thompson Street Radials
Tires are a month old
Nice JVC Headunit
12" Kicker Comp VR w/ 1000 watt amp
